Those with a love of art can attend the upcoming Vallejo Art Walk this November to browse through the works of numerous talented artists.
The Vallejo Art Walk invites artists throughout the community to sell and share their pieces on sidewalks around the city. The event is held every month, giving people many opportunities to check out the festivities. Attendees can see art from studios like the Gemini Gallery, Whitney Smith Pottery, and Nikkibana Floral Design. Vallejo Open Studios will be a new gallery featured for November and December.
Aside from viewing the pieces made by local artists, the Vallejo Art Walk will feature music provided by IntegriTea and JAM-EZ at Vallejo Vinyl & Pinball. Guests can buy food and drinks from vendors such as China Cafe and V-Town Provisions. The Cal Maritime Anchor Center will also have food available, in addition to indoor artist shops. The Vallejo Art Walk will be held on Friday, November 8 from 5:00 pm to 10:00 pm. There is no price to attend the event, and guests are not required to register before the festival is held. Those who are unable to make the art walk in November can head to Vallejo again on Friday, December 13.
